Beijing s Air Quality May Finally Be Improving But it Still Ain t Great

In February, a Chinese celebrity journalist named Chai Jing released a video on the Internet about the damage air pollution was causing her country. During the week it was online (before Chinese censors pulled it down), people viewed the video 200 million times. Air pollution is perhaps on more Chinese minds than ever before. China targets companies and traffic to improve air quality for Winter Olympics

Beijing and neighbouring province of Hebei given powers to close businesses and restrict vehicle use during the Games.

Beijing meets state air quality standards for first time in 2021

China declared war on pollution in 2014 after a series of hazardous smog build-ups in Beijing and elsewhere triggered widespread public anger.
